As a Commercial Business Director for the CVRM Primary Care Team, you will play a crucial role in leveraging our scientific capabilities to positively impact patients' lives!
Accountabilities
- Understand disease states and treatment protocols prevalent in primary care settings and varied healthcare environments, influencing healthcare providers through evidence-based discussions.
- Apply strong analytical objectivity to focus on prescribing patterns and optimize account strategies.
- Implement effective resource management strategies to impact lower-scale and high-frequency environments while enforcing accountability within sales plans.
- Establish business objectives, evaluate performance, and get results through effective execution of Brand strategies.
- Ensure sales forecasts and operational budgets are met or exceeded within the therapeutic area at a regional level.
- Foster a Growth Mindset, continuous learning, and improvement by using new technology and data insights to enhance patient care and streamline process efficiency.
- Communicate and implement a vision that aligns with broader organizational goals and local priorities of primary care.
- Inspire a culture that embraces curiosity, ownership, accountability, and engagement within the team through mentoring, coaching, and continuous feed forward.
Essential Skills/Experience
- Bachelor’s Degree
- 8+ years of demonstrated Sales or Commercial experience or a combination of pharmaceutical, healthcare, scientific, clinical, institutional, or related industry
- 5+ years proven leadership capabilities and/or people management experience
- A valid driver’s license and safe driving record

The annual base pay for this position ranges from $203,816 to $305,724 . Base pay offered may vary depending on multiple individualized factors, including market location,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. In addition, our positions offer a short-term incentive bonus opportunity; eligibility to participate in our equity-based long-term incentive program and commission payment eligibility. Benefits offered included a qualified retirement program [401(k) plan]; paid vacation and holidays; paid leaves; and, health benefits including medical, prescription drug, dental, and vision coverage in accordance with the terms and conditions of the applicable plans.
